Titles are: A Bunnan Bui, A Stoir Re: Slow airs in traditional Irish music sessions The problem with slow airs in sessions is that everyone wants to join in. Airs really only work with one good soloist and one sensitive accompanist. If you start a heart wrenching lament that some guy wrote for his newly dead wife, and half a dozen people start plinky-plonking banjos and mandolins or parping on accordions it really, really doesn t work.
